Finding Your Idiosyncrasies at the Start of the Year
At the beginning of the year, it’s important to find your idiosyncrasies. They’re going to be certain things that you will have a tendency to do under pressure.You’ll take things for granted: Muzzle too high. Muzzle going up. Not being comfortable with the muzzle being well in front of a right-to-left bird. Eyes moving when you call “pull.”There are certain things that are going to be yours for this year. Now is a grea... Questions to Ask Yourself About Your Scorecard
- Are you in sync and stabilizing every shot?- Are you staying in the shots long enough to have a post-visual routine confirming to your brain to do it again, which in turn becomes your pre-shot visual?- Are you controlling your pace after your quiet eye, keeping your eyes still, thinking of nothing?- Are you controlling your pace after your quiet eye, keeping your eyes still, thinking of nothing?
